Summary

Active Record Tenanted's override of Active Storage's DiskService#path for does not validate that the resolved filesystem path remains within the storage root directory. If a blob key containing path traversal sequences (e.g. ../) is used, it could allow reading, writing, or deleting arbitrary files on the server. Blob keys are expected to be trusted strings, but some applications could be passing user input as keys and would be affected.

Mitigation

Upgrade to Active Record Tenanted v0.7.0 or later.
As a workaround, do not use untrusted user input as blob keys. Blob keys are expected to be trusted strings.
